Music Album Review: The Jesus and Mary Chain - "Damage and Joy" (10/10)

This comeback of sorts is both reminiscent of the Jesus and Mary Chain’s great early work and also fits into today’s alt-rock formats. Soaring, gorgeous guitar sounds replace the early gritty, back-to-the-audience pre-grunge sounds that set them on the pantheon of innovative rock & rollers. There are even love songs! Once in early interviews, they cited Burt Bacharach and Hal David as songwriting influences, and that has always been evident in their songwriting. We all grow up, hopefully, and they have grown up well.
